Solid timber flooring is made from a single piece of wood, typically hardwood, and is available in a variety of species. It’s the most traditional form of timber flooring and provides a premium, authentic look. Designed core engineered flooring uses cost-effective composite materials for its core. While the surface layer mimics various woods beautifully, this option is generally more affordable without sacrificing style.

This also means that engineered hardwood flooring options with a thicker wear layer are often more expensive, but they will last much longer than thinner options. For example, if you have engineered hardwood floors with a 1mm wear layer, you should never sand and refinish them—although you can recoat them. As a result, flooring with a 1mm wear layer has an estimated lifespan of about 20 to 30 years. If you have a 2mm wear layer, you can safely sand and refinish it with a light sand up to one time under the manufacturers guidelines, giving it an estimated lifespan of 30 to 40 years. A 3mm wear layer can withstand up to two light sand refinishes and has an estimated lifespan of 40 to 50 years. The thickest available wear layer, 6mm, can take four refinishes and has an estimated lifespan of anywhere between 50 to 100 years as a result.
